Output ab8df60279d5482316fb34f34889fda0343e501812241ecf9e931af24abc288f:1

value
5320658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 542caffa38b672c0c4935680acb492a46cbb762a OP_EQUAL
address
39N6DbNAjUzYnvPiS1sL39hwTA56CzfC8W
transaction
ab8df60279d5482316fb34f34889fda0343e501812241ecf9e931af24abc288f
spent
true